french bee

About
French bee is a French low-cost, long-haul airline based at Paris Orly Airport. Established in 2016 as French Blue, it rebranded to French bee in 2018. A subsidiary of the Dubreuil Group, French bee operates a fleet of Airbus A350 aircraft, offering flights to destinations such as Reunion Island, Tahiti, San Francisco, and New York. The airline focuses on providing affordable travel options with a range of optional services, catering to leisure travelers seeking cost-effective long-haul flights.

TAP Portugal

About
TAP Air Portugal is the national flag carrier and the largest airline in Portugal, with its main hub at Humberto Delgado Airport in Lisbon. As a member of the Star Alliance, TAP operates an average of 2,500 flights per week to more than 90 destinations in over 30 countries. Many of its aircraft feature USB outlets for charging devices, while most long-haul flights include complimentary onboard entertainment with movies, TV shows, music, and games. For travelers looking for affordable options, TAP also offers low-cost fares on select routes, making it easy to find cheap flights with the airline.

Air Canada

About
Air Canada is Canada's largest airline and flag carrier, headquartered in Saint-Laurent, Quebec. Founded in 1937 as Trans-Canada Air Lines, it was renamed Air Canada in 1964 and fully privatized in 1989. As a founding member of Star Alliance, Air Canada provides scheduled passenger and cargo services to over 220 destinations across six continents. The airline operates a diverse fleet, including Airbus A320 family aircraft, Boeing 737 MAX, Boeing 777, and Boeing 787 Dreamliner for both short and long-haul routes. Air Canada also offers leisure travel packages through its subsidiary, Air Canada Vacations.

For international flights we recommend to arrive 2.5 to 3 hours before departure. Please check the website of your departure airport if in doubt. Some airports may offer booking time slots for security checks or offer additional information on when to get there based on time of day.
Most airlines permit carry-on bags that fit within specific dimensions (e.g., 22 x 14 x 9 inches or 56 x 36 x 23 cm), including handles and wheels. Bags must fit in the overhead bin or under the seat in front of you.
Many airlines impose weight limits, commonly ranging between 7 kg (15 lbs) and 12 kg (26 lbs). Typically, passengers are allowed one carry-on bag and one personal item (for example a purse, laptop bag, or backpack). Personal items must fit under the seat in front of you. Budget Airlines (like Ryanair or Wizz Air) have stricter size and weight limits, often requiring fees for larger carry-ons. Full-Service Airlines have more lenient policies, sometimes including more spacious dimensions or higher weight limits depending on your ticket class.
The list of items prohibited on an airplane varies by country and airline, but in general, the following items are not allowed in carry-on or checked baggage: Weapons and self-defence items, sharp objects, flammable materials, explosives, toxic substances, or liquids over 100ml (except for medications and baby essentials). In checked baggage, firearms (without authorization), explosives, large lithium batteries, and hazardous chemicals are prohibited. Electronic cigarettes must be in carry-on bags, while alcohol and dry ice have restrictions. Always check with your airline for specific regulations.
